const UTILS = require('../utils');
/**
* @file Terminus Rules
* @license Apache Version 2
* Abstract object to support applying matching rules to result sets and documents
* sub-classes are FrameRule and WOQLRule - this just has common functions
*/
function TerminusRule() {}
/**
* @param {Boolean} tf - the rule will match all literals or all non-literals
*/
TerminusRule.prototype.literal = function (tf) {
if (typeof tf === 'undefined') {
return this.pattern.literal;
}
this.pattern.literal = tf;
return this;
};
/**
* @param {[TYPE_URLS]} list - parameters are types identified by prefixed URLS (xsd:string...)
*/
TerminusRule.prototype.type = function (...list) {
if (typeof list === 'undefined' || list.length === 0) {
return this.pattern.type;
}
this.pattern.type = list;
return this;
};
/**
* Specifies the scope of a rule - row / cell / object / property / * .. what part
* of the result does the rule apply to
*/
TerminusRule.prototype.scope = function (scope) {
if (typeof scope === 'undefined') {
return this.pattern.scope;
}
this.pattern.scope = scope;
return this;
};
/**
* Specifies that the rule matches a specific value
*/
TerminusRule.prototype.value = function (...val) {
if (typeof val === 'undefined') {
return this.pattern.value;
}
this.pattern.value = val;
return this;
};
/**
* Produces a canonical json format to represent the rule
*/
TerminusRule.prototype.json = function (mjson) {
if (!mjson) {
const njson = {};
if (this.pattern) njson.pattern = this.pattern.json();
if (this.rule) njson.rule = this.rule;
return njson;
}
if (mjson.pattern) this.pattern.setPattern(mjson.pattern);
if (mjson.rule) this.rule = mjson.rule;
return this;
};
/**
* Contained Pattern Object to encapsulate pattern matching
* @param {Object} pattern
*/
// eslint-disable-next-line no-unused-vars
function TerminusPattern(pattern) {}
TerminusPattern.prototype.setPattern = function (pattern) {
if (typeof pattern.literal !== 'undefined') this.literal = pattern.literal;
if (pattern.type) this.type = pattern.type;
if (pattern.scope) this.scope = pattern.scope;
if (pattern.value) this.value = pattern.value;
};
TerminusPattern.prototype.json = function () {
const json = {};
if (typeof this.literal !== 'undefined') json.literal = this.literal;
if (this.type) json.type = this.type;
if (this.scope) json.scope = this.scope;
if (this.value) json.value = this.value;
return json;
};
/**
* Tests whether the passed values matches the basic pattern
*/
TerminusPattern.prototype.testBasics = function (scope, value) {
if (this.scope && scope && this.scope !== scope) return false;
if (this.type) {
const dt = value['@type'];
if (!dt || !this.testValue(dt, this.type)) return false;
}
if (typeof this.literal !== 'undefined') {
if (!(this.literal === !(typeof value['@type'] === 'undefined'))) return false;
}
if (typeof this.value !== 'undefined') {
if (!this.testValue(value, this.value)) return false;
}
return true;// passed all tests
};
TerminusPattern.prototype.testValue = function (value, constraint) {
if (!value) return null;
const vundertest = (value['@value'] ? value['@value'] : value);
if (typeof constraint === 'function') return constraint(vundertest);
// eslint-disable-next-line no-param-reassign
if (constraint && !Array.isArray(constraint)) constraint = [constraint];
// eslint-disable-next-line no-plusplus
for (let i = 0; i < constraint.length; i++) {
const nc = constraint[i];
if (typeof vundertest === 'string') {
if (this.stringMatch(nc, vundertest)) return true;
} else if (typeof vundertest === 'number') {
if (this.numberMatch(nc, vundertest)) return true;
}
}
return false;
};
/**
* Unpacks an array into a list of arguments
* @param {Boolean} nonstring - if set, the values will be double-quoted only when
* they are strings, otherwise, all will be quoted as strings
*/
TerminusPattern.prototype.unpack = function (arr, nonstring) {
let str = '';
if (nonstring) {
// eslint-disable-next-line no-plusplus
for (let i = 0; i < arr.length; i++) {
if (typeof arr[i] === 'string') {
str += `"${arr[i]}"`;
} else {
str += arr[i];
}
if (i < (arr.length - 1)) str += ', ';
}
} else {
str = `"${arr.join('","')}"`;
}
return str;
};
TerminusPattern.prototype.IDsMatch = function (ida, idb) {
return UTILS.compareIDs(ida, idb);
};
TerminusPattern.prototype.classIDsMatch = function (ida, idb) {
return this.IDsMatch(ida, idb);
};
TerminusPattern.prototype.propertyIDsMatch = function (ida, idb) {
const match = this.IDsMatch(ida, idb);
return match;
};
TerminusPattern.prototype.rangeIDsMatch = function (ida, idb) {
return this.IDsMatch(ida, idb);
};
TerminusPattern.prototype.valuesMatch = function (vala, valb) {
return vala === valb;
};
TerminusPattern.prototype.numberMatch = function (vala, valb) {
if (typeof vala === 'string') {
try {
// eslint-disable-next-line no-eval
return eval(valb + vala);
} catch (e) {
return false;
}
}
return vala === valb;
};
TerminusPattern.prototype.stringMatch = function (vala, valb) {
if (vala.substring(0, 1) === '/') {
const pat = new RegExp(vala.substring(1));
return pat.test(valb);
}
return vala === valb;
};
module.exports = { TerminusRule, TerminusPattern };
